Dragon Quest’s creator accidentally revealed when we’ll learn more about Dragon Quest 12

We might learn more about Dragon Quest 12 before the end of the month

Dragon Quest 7 Reimagined artwork, featuring Ruff, Maribel, the Hero, and Kiefer aboard their ship Image: Square Enix

Yuji Horii, the creator of Square Enix’s RPG franchise Dragon Quest, just accidentally revealed when fans will learn more about the next games in the series.

On a now-delisted episode of the KosoKoso broadcast, Horii teased an upcoming livestream for the Dragon Quest series in which new games would be discussed. Gematsu translated his comments. “We’ll be doing a live stream on May 27. I think we’ll be able to make an announcement about the next game,” Horii stated. “We’ll also have various other things besides the next game, so please look forward to it.”

The fact that the KosoKoso video has since been taken down suggests that Horii said something he was not supposed to, spoiling a surprise for Dragon Quest fans. Still, fans of the RPG series should be excited that we may soon learn more about games like Dragon Quest 12: The Flames of Fate.

Dragon Quest 12: The Flames of Fate was first teased in a 2021 livestream celebrating the series’ 35th anniversary. Square Enix has rarely discussed the game since then, so a 40th-anniversary presentation seems like the perfect place for Dragon Quest 12 to reemerge after five years of speculation.

Thankfully, Dragon Quest fans haven’t been starved for games over the past half-decade. The first three Dragon Quest games all received HD-2D remakes, while Dragon Quest 7 Reimagined remade the PlayStation RPG in a different style earlier this year. Spin-offs like Dragon Quest Treasures, Dragon Quest Monsters: The Dark Prince, and Infinity Strash: Dragon Quest – The Adventure of Dai have also kept fans occupied.

With less than three weeks to go until Dragon Quest’s 40th anniversary, Square Enix will have to confirm whether what Yuji Horii said was accurate sooner rather than later. Even if that doesn’t materialize, fans can celebrate the fact that the first Dragon Quest has just been inducted into the World Video Game Hall of Fame and continue to wait for a Dragon Quest 12-related announcement.
